NEW YORK (PIX11 --- After the ball dropped in Times Square, hundreds of sanitation workers had cleared the city streets by daybreak, officials said. Approximately 200 workers used mechanical brooms and backpack blowers to pick up roughly 100,000 pounds of litter, confetti, and party hats before sunrise, according to the Department of Sanitation. “Every year, [...]
